DDR Overview
Double Data Rate (DDR) SDRAM is the latest Memory Module technology
approved by Joint Electron Device Engineering Council (JEDEC).
The size and structure are similar to conventional Single
Data Rate (SDR) SDRAM module but works differently. With a
one-open-key and 184-pins PCB design, DDR module reads data
on both the upper and lower frequencies of each clock cycle,
which stands for the data rate is doubled. It may also burst
the peak bandwidth up to 2.1GB(DDR266, 133MHz) per second.
DDR module can deliver superior memory performance, and its
low 2.5V operating voltage is complied with Stub Series Terminated
Logic - 2 (SSTL-2) standard.
